AWS Amplify
Development
AWS Amplify is a set of tools and services that enables developers to build full-stack web and mobile apps more easily. It handles hosting, code generation, authentication, managed GraphQL API backend, analytics, and much more.

Rclone
File Management
Rclone is an open source command line program for syncing files and directories to and from a variety of cloud storage providers such as Google Drive, Amazon S3, Dropbox, Microsoft OneDrive, and more. It is fast, versatile, and provides extensive configuration options for advanced use cases.
